It’s been this way ever since you were a child.
Bruises. Cuts. Fractures. It was all you really knew. You never understood why you were so fragile—if anything, you probably needed a caution sticker stuck to you at all times.
Rin knew about your little… habits. Back then, it wasn’t anything worth paying attention to. There were plenty of clumsy kids—you weren’t special.
…but when it kept happening again…and again. He finally had enough.
(:̲̅:̲̅:̲̅[̲̅:♡:]̲̅:̲̅:̲̅:̲̅)
“Oof—!”
A small grunt leaves your lips as you trip over who knows what on your way to class.
You hit the pavement hard, the impact scraping your knee. The thin fabric of your tights tears instantly, and it doesn’t take long for blood to start seeping through the material.
You sigh.
Typical.
Like always, you move to push yourself up—ready to brush it off and pretend nothing happened.
But before you could even try to stand up—
“What the hell do you think you’re doing?”
You freeze. Your eyes shooting up to look right at him as if you were doing something you weren’t supposed to.
Rin’s voice cuts through the air, sharp and irritated, as he crouches down in front of you without hesitation, eyes already scanning your injury.
“Rin! I’m fine,” you insist quickly, waving him off. “It doesn’t even hurt. I’ll just clean it up in class—”
“No.”
He cuts you off instantly.
“I’m taking you to the nurse.” His tone was firm—non-negotiable.
Before you can protest again, he’s already lifting you up like it’s nothing.
“Rin—! Put me down!” you whisper-yell, heat rushing to your face as a few students glance your way.
“Stop moving,” he mutters, adjusting his hold slightly. “You’ll make it worse.”
And just like that, any argument died in your throat.
(:̲̅:̲̅:̲̅[̲̅:♡:]̲̅:̲̅:̲̅:̲̅)
Once inside the nurse’s office, Rin sets you down carefully on one of the beds; far gentler than you expected.
He doesn’t waste a second.
Already turning away, he grabs supplies like he’s done this a hundred times before.
“Rin, seriously, I’m okay,” you try again, softer this time. “It’s just a scratch—”
“Can you stop, Y/N?”
You go quiet immediately.
Your eyes widen slightly at his tone—not angry, just… strained.
“Just let me take care of you… please.”
…That does it.
Your lips press together, and you nod—finally giving in.
Rin exhales quietly, like he didn’t realize he’d been holding his breath, before kneeling down in front of you again.
Up close, his brows are slightly furrowed, his focus entirely on your knee.
“This is gonna sting,” he says, voice flatter now as he pours alcohol onto a cotton pad.
You roll your eyes lightly. “Rin, I’ve had cuts before, I’ll be fi—”
The second the alcohol touches your skin—
“Ah—!”
You hiss, flinching slightly.
Rin pauses for just a second… then continues, a little more careful this time.
“I told you it would hurt,” he mutters, quieter now.
“…Shut up,” you mumble, avoiding his gaze.
A faint—barely there—twitch at the corner of his lips appears before disappearing just as quickly.
Once he’s done cleaning it, he places a bandage over your knee, pressing it down gently.
But… he doesn’t move.
He stays there, kneeling in front of you.
“Rin?” you tilt your head slightly, a small smile creeping onto your face. “What are you doing?”
“…Stay still.”
His voice is softer this time. Not an order…more like a quiet request.
Your smile softens.
Then, after a brief pause—
“…Promise me you’ll be more careful.”
Your breath catches.
“What—?”
Heat rushes to your cheeks almost instantly at his words. Were you hearing him correctly?
“Y/N,” he murmurs, finally looking up at you.
His ears are faintly pink.
“…Just promise.”
There’s something vulnerable in the way he says it—something rare.
You swallow.
“…I promise.”
For a second, he just looks at you.
Then he lets out a quiet breath, tension leaving his shoulders.
“…Good.”
He stands up quickly after that, like the moment never happened, his usual scowl slipping right back into place.
“Come on. Let’s go.” He huffs, turning towards the door without waiting.
You blink… then smile to yourself, hopping off the bed to follow after him.
You fall into step beside him easily.
“You need to buy new tights,” he says bluntly.
You snort, “Yeah, I know that, captain obvious.”
“…Whatever.”
But he slows his pace—just slightly—so you can keep up.
